Greek For 373
Word anapano
Pronunciation an-ap-ow'-o
Definition from 303 and 3973; (reflexively) to repose (literally or figuratively (be exempt), remain); by implication, to refresh:

take ease, refresh, (give, take) rest.
Root(s) 303  3973
